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ained messes.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Professional help is essential for large-scale water dam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es DIY can spread damage and create further problems.
Hidden mold growth in attic No Yes Professional help is essential for identifying and remediating hidden mold growth.
Small fire damage in kitchen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ained fires.
Large-scale water damage from burst pipe No Yes Professional help is essential for large-scale water damage and preventing further problems.

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ost In The 2476 Area

Prices for emergency damage restoration v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 2476 area.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should serve as a rough guide only.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ials
Mold Inspection and Testing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of mold
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of contamination
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of damage
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of materials

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ates and are happy to discuss your options in more detail.
